308P Physical Measurements (4)
An introduction to metrology, this course will emphasize physical measurements
in technology and trade as well as in daily life. Material will include the
historical development of measurement units, from cubits to meters, especially
since 1960; gravitational versus absolute systems; the International System of
Units (SI); organizations, treaties and statutes; accuracy vs. precision; and
numerical values: conventions, conversions and rounding. Student work will
involve laboratory exercises, exams, practicum work and homework assignments
(brief essays and/or problem solutions). Prerequisite: Math 110 or 150 (or
equivalent) Summer.
